
The Basics
Score: #9 Roanoke 50 | #3 Randolph-Macon 62
Records: Maroons 6-1 / 1-1 ODAC | Yellow Jackets 8-1 / 2-0 ODAC
Location: Salem, Va.
The Lead: Two of the top 10 teams in the nation took the court at the Cregger Center when 9th ranked Roanoke played host to #3 Randolph-Macon in an early season Old Dominion Athletic Conference (ODAC) showdown. The game would be tied mid-way through the first half with the visitors enjoying a two-point lead, 27-25, at the break. The first five-minutes of the second half would belong to Macon as the Yellow Jackets used a 17-3 surge to take control. Roanoke would get to within 10 but as the final horn sounded RMC picked up the ODAC win, 62-50.
How it Happened:
- Randolph-Macon scored first and held the lead until a Brandon Ellington layup tied the score at 10-10. With 10:44 left in the first half, Justin Kuthan converted a layup and finished off the 3-ponit play with a free throw to give RC a 15-12 edge.
- Two-minutes later, Ellinington hit one of two from the stripe to give the Maroons their largest lead of the afternoon, 18-14. After a RMC rally, Kasey Draper hit a jump shot to tie the game at 20-20, it would be the final tie of the afternoon as Randolph-Macon used a 5-0 spurt to put themselves in front to stay.
- Down five, Nick Price scored from long range to make it 27-25 at the half.
- After another Price three-pointer, 31-28, the Yellow Jackets scored the next 15 points to take control.
- In the final minute, Kuthan cut the deficit to 10 but Roanoke could get no closer as Randolph-Macon took the top 10 matchup, 62-50.
- Draper finished with a game high 19 points while adding four rebounds, two assists and a steal. Kuthan and Zach Rosenthal came off the bench to each score seven points as Roanoke did enjoy a 19-5 edge in bench points. Ethan Rohan tied for game-high honors with seven boards with Kuthan adding five.
